History of Tamriel tells about the first states on Tamriel's territory. Tamriel is the most known mainland on the Nirn Planet. Also Tamriel is the name of the Empire that occupied the whole mainland before the Oblivion Crisis. Tamriel means Dawn's Beauty in Aldmeris.This book make you to expirience life of different cultures such as Redguards, Imperials, Altmers,Argonians,Bosmers,Dunmers,Khajiits,Nords and Orcs.
